2020-02176 In the Matter of Andrea Venius Sutherland, respondent, v Ramakish Meneil, appellant. (Docket No. F-5049-11/19G)
| DECISION & ORDER ON MOTION |
Appeal by Ramakish Meneil from an order and judgment (one paper) of the Family Court, Westchester County, dated January 7, 2020.
On the Court's own motion, it is
ORDERED that the appeal is dismissed, without costs or disbursements, as no appeal lies from an order of a support magistrate before objections have been reviewed by a judge of the Family Court (see Family Ct Act § 439[e]).
